config.json / pihole_monitor.py:
- RUN defaults to "disabled", matching every other non-core plugin.
- VERIFY_SSL split into PRIMARY_VERIFY_SSL / SECONDARY_VERIFY_SSL -
each instance can be http/https independently. Settings reordered so
each *_VERIFY_SSL sits right under its matching *_PASSWORD.
- GRAPHQL_TOKEN removed; graphql_token now reads the core API_TOKEN
setting instead of a plugin-specific duplicate.
- GRAPHQL_URL replaced with a GET_OWNER boolean - the endpoint is now
derived from this app's own GRAPHQL_PORT (single source of truth)
instead of a URL the user had to keep in sync by hand.
- HISTORY_LENGTH (run count) replaced with HISTORY_DAYS (a real time
window): state now stores [timestamp, delta] samples and
trim_history() drops anything older than the window, so the
baseline means the same thing regardless of schedule - a faster
schedule adds more data points instead of shrinking the window.
- STATE_FILE moved from the log folder to dbFolderPath, so the rolling
anomaly baseline survives NetAlertX upgrades instead of being wiped
with the logs.
- netalertx_device_owner() (1 GraphQL call per device) replaced by
netalertx_device_owners() (1 call per run, batched) - avoids N
blocking round-trips on a large network.
- Fixed a zero-baseline bug: `bool(... and baseline and ...)` silently
exempted a device with an all-zero blocked-query history (0.0 is
falsy in Python) from ever being flagged, even on its first real
spike. Now checks `baseline is not None`.
- Fixed the placeholder-MAC filter: only excluded the literal "ip-::",
not Pi-hole's general "ip-<address>" placeholder pattern. Caught
downstream by is_mac() either way, but now the actual placeholder
check does what it looks like it does.
- Fixed a cumulative-counter bug: Pi-hole's /api/stats/top_clients
returns a count that's cumulative since FTL last started, not a
per-interval or daily-resetting one (confirmed against FTL's own
source and long-standing user reports that it doesn't reset at
midnight). Comparing that raw total directly against a rolling
average made any device's ordinary growing traffic look like an
escalating anomaly. compute_delta() now diffs each run's raw count
against the previous run's (state gained a per-key last_raw
reference point alongside the delta history) - None (not 0) on the
first-ever run for a device or right after a counter reset, so
those runs re-anchor the reference point instead of fabricating or
swallowing a delta.
- RUN_SCHD default changed from every 6 hours to every 5 minutes now
that the baseline window is real days, not run count, so a frequent
schedule only adds data points instead of narrowing the window; also
matches the default most other device-scanner plugins use.
- RUN_SCHD gained the same live cron-validity checkmark ARPSCAN and
other scanner plugins use (a ✓/✗ icon next to the field, validated
client-side against a regex) - reuses the existing generic
validateRegex() widget, nothing plugin-specific to build.
Tests: 48 tests (up from 37), 99% line+branch coverage. Every fix
above verified via mutation testing (deliberately broken, confirmed
the relevant test fails, then restored).
